Ingredients

Serves
1 serving
Glass
Old-fashioned glass
Prep
5 min
  • 1 1/2 ozAñejo rum
  • 1/2 ozTia maria
  • 1/2 ozVodka
  • 1 ozOrange juice
  • 1 tspLemon juice

Method

Preparation

  1. 01

    In a shaker half-filled with ice cubes, combine all of the ingredients. Shake well. Strain into an old-fashioned glass almost filled with ice cubes.
